Hi fabrice, I dont’t know whether this the best solution, but you can use the following definition of the MPgraphic Funny: \startuseMPgraphic{Funny} interim linecap := butt ; path p ; p := unitsquare xyscaled (OverlayWidth,OverlayHeight) ; drawoptions (withpen pencircle scaled 6.5pt withcolor \MPcolor{MyColorA}) ; draw lrcorner p --urcorner p --ulcorner p withcolor white; draw ulcorner p --llcorner p ; \stopuseMPgraphic If necessary, you can use a backgroundcolor instead of white for the part of the path p which is to be invisible. Best regards: OK
On 29 Aug 2015, at 10:56, Fabrice Couvreur
wrote: Hi, I want to draw the left border of the rectangle, but it is drawn in the middle. Why ? Thank you, Fabrice
\setupcolors[state=start]
\definecolor[MyColorA][c=0.3, m=0.00, y=0.00, k=0.05]
\defineoverlay [Funny] [\useMPgraphic{Funny}]
\startuseMPgraphic{Funny} interim linecap := butt ; path p ; p := unitsquare xyscaled (OverlayWidth,OverlayHeight) ; drawoptions (withpen pencircle scaled 6.5pt withcolor \MPcolor{MyColorA}) ; draw ulcorner p--llcorner p ; \stopuseMPgraphic
\defineframedtext [Methode] [before={\blank}, after={\blank}, frame=off, background=Funny, width=\textwidth, height=fit]
\starttext
\startMethode \input knuth \stopMethode
\stoptext ___________________________________________________________________________________ If your question is of interest to others as well, please add an entry to the Wiki!
ma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context webpage : http://www.pragma-ade.nl / http://tex.aanhet.net archive : http://foundry.supelec.fr/projects/contextrev/ wiki : http://contextgarden.net ___________________________________________________________________________________